In early February 2025, Brazilian poker player Carlos “S1NISTR0” Rocha achieved a triumphant victory in the prestigious Venom Mystery KO tournament with a $2,650 buy-in and a guaranteed prize pool of $8,000,000. The event attracted 3,519 participants, surpassing the guarantee and reaching an impressive total prize pool of $8,797,500.
Rocha entered the final table as the chip leader with 64 big blinds. Throughout the heads-up stage, he maintained his advantage, controlling the game and leaving no chances for his opponents. A key moment was the elimination of Ukrainian player “Runner114” in 4th place, after which the remaining three finalists—Rocha, Germany’s Daniel “SmilleThHero” Smiljkovic, and Denmark’s Theo “Thelittle200” Arnóldi—agreed to a deal, securing their payouts.
As a result of the deal, Carlos Rocha secured an impressive win of $748,547, including $135,000 in bounty rewards. This victory became the largest of his career. Before this success, he had played over 8,000 tournaments on the PokerKing platform, earning a total profit of around $160,000.
